Learn some of the key components of the Secure 2.0 Act of 2022.The SSA distributions are not directly connected to the employee bonuses. This year, the SSA distribution was higher, as it reflected the capital from the sale of the USAA Asset Management to Victory Capital. Earn 2 points per $1 spent at gas stations and on dining; 1 point per $1 on all other purchases.Quoted: USAA is a mutual insurance company. It is owned by the policy holders. Like any corporation, if the company has a profitable year, it returns a portion of teh profits to the owners. Except instead of going out to shareholders as dividends, it goes to the policyholders as a subscriber account distribution.We would like to show you a description here but the site won't allow us.To join USAA, separated military personnel must have received a discharge type of Honorable or General Under Honorable Conditions. Credit cards are issued by USAA Savings Bank and serviced by USAA Federal …The bend points in the year 2024 PIA formula, $1,174 and $7,078, apply for workers becoming eligible in 2024. See the table of bend points for the bend points applicable in past years. For example, a person who had maximum-taxable earnings in each year since age 22, and who retires at age 62 in 2024, would have an AIME equal to $13,100.

Payroll deduction funnels the money into each trust. In 2024, the Social Security payroll tax is 12.4 percent, but you only pay 6.2 percent of your wages. The company that employs you pays the other half. The income level at which that tax stops is $168,600. Self-employed individuals must pay the entire 12.4 percent.
